No. NEXUS is our platform and delivery framework. Our team uses it to design and build workflow applications for your business, based on your systems, users, and processes.
No. NEXUS extends your existing systems instead of replacing them. It helps create modern workflow applications around your ERP, backend, and operational platforms.
Yes. NEXUS is designed to work with ERP platforms, CRMs, databases, APIs, and legacy systems — including situations where companies are transitioning from older systems to platforms like SAP or Oracle.
AI can be embedded where it adds practical value — assisted data capture, workflow summaries, recommendations, exception alerts, document interpretation, and natural language interactions.
We typically begin by identifying one painful workflow, defining the users and integrations required, and then building a focused pilot before scaling to more departments or processes.
For a focused workflow, a working pilot can usually be delivered in weeks, depending on scope, integrations, and user requirements.
